US: Solar energy ‘to convert CO2 into diesel fuel’

An alliance of US industry, academic and government organisations has been formed with the aim of commercialising technologies that will ‘utilise concentrated solar energy to convert waste carbon dioxide (CO2) into diesel fuel’. It is being led by Albuquerque, New Mexico based Sandia National Laboratories, which is owned by Lockheed Martin.
